North Ave. Hotel

Public Hearing for North Ave. Hotel


At a Plan Commission Public Hearing on Monday, January 27, 2020, a proposed Holiday Inn Express at 451 E. North Ave, north of the Lombard Lagoon, was unanimously recommended (6-0), pending 14 conditions. This item will be forwarded to the Village Board for consideration at their February 20, 2020 meeting. A full list of conditions, a FAQ, and a video of the meeting are available at  www.villageoflombard.org/northavehotel.

Avoid Thefts: Follow the 9 p.m. Routine


Lombard Police remind residents to remove valuables from vehicles, to lock vehicles and homes, and to turn on exterior lights, as part of a “9 p.m. routine” every night. These precautions have been shown to help deter thefts.
